Efficacy and Safety of a 4% Hydroquinone Cream for the Treatment of Melasma

To assess the ability of a new 4% Hydroquinone formulation (Melanoderm 4% Crema) to reduce melasma on the face, using a split-face randomization design, evaluating the MASI Score from baseline to week 4 and week 8, in both half-faces receiving active treatment vs. placebo.

To assess the tolerance of a new 4% Hydroquinone formulation (Melanoderm 4% Crema) on the face.

To assess patients' satisfaction regarding Melanoderm 4% Crema after 8 weeks.

Inclusion criteria

  • Adult women aged between 18-65 years old.
  • Fitzpatrick phototypes I to IV.
  • Presenting moderate to severe facial melasma facial, with a basal Melasma Area and Severity Index (MASI Index) between 10 and 20.
  • Women of childbearing potential must use an adequate contraceptive method to avoid pregnancy and must have a negative pregnancy test in a maximum of 72 hours before receiving the trial treatment.
  • Breastfeeding women will not be included in the study.
  • Having given freely and expressly her informed consent.

Exclusion criteria

  • Those with any history of allergy or hypersensitivity to a cosmetic product, hydroquinone, or one of the ingredients of the investigational products.
  • Fitzpatrick phototype V.
  • Skin pigmentation diseases different to melasma.
  • Evidence of active cancer disease or diagnosis of cancer in the last year.
  • Those receiving any topical or oral treatment that could interfere with melasma.
  • Pregnant or breastfeeding women, or those expecting to get pregnant during the study.
  • Evidence or suspicion of low compliance with the study visits and procedures.
  • Participation in other clinical trial simultaneously or in the previous 3 months.

Primary outcomes

  1. To assess the ability of a new 4% Hydroquinone formulation (Melanoderm 4% Crema) to reduce melasma on the face.

    Time frame: Baseline, week 4, week 8.

    Efficacy assessments will be measured by the Melasma Area and Severity Index (MASI Index) at baseline, week 4 and week 8 (end of treatment).

Secondary outcomes

  1. To assess the tolerance of a new 4% Hydroquinone formulation (Melanoderm 4% Crema) on the face.

    Time frame: Week 4, Week 8, Follow-up period (Week 12)

    Adverse events will be recorded throughout the study and 30 days after the end of treatment.

Other outcomes

  1. To assess patients' satisfaction regarding Melanoderm 4% Crema.

    Time frame: Week 8

    Patients' satisfaction in terms of efficacy and safety will be evaluated by a Visual Analogic Scale at week 8, which will be completed for each side of the face independently.
